Musician Reggie Zippy of Reggie 'n' Bollie fame, has reportedly lost his mother.
Madam Cecilia Koomson is said to have passed on Sunday, August 29. The cause of death is yet to be established.
Announcing her death on social media, Reggie took to Instagram to share a video of himself and his mom singing and dancing.
The heartbroken musician stated that following his mother's death, he is not only in pain but lost, confused and shocked.
"You don’t know pain until you lose your beloved mother. I am lost, confused and shocked. Ceccy, I am coming to join you wherever you are, this is not what we planned. WE LIVE TOGETHER, WE DIE TOGETHER. Only Mum, Only Son, PERIOD!!. Don’t rest yet cuz I am coming home. GOD MADE A MISTAKE YESTERDAY,” he said.
Other celebrities including Gloria Sarfo, Prince Bright of BukBak, Stacy Amoateng and some fans consoled Reggie under his post.
Stacy Amoateng wrote, "Oh dear son, God knows best. You are a fighter, you are a survivor. This too will pass. It is well. My heart goes out to the entire family. Remember, you are loved."
